Unveiling the World of Animalia: Motile vs Sessile Life Forms

The world of Animalia is vast and diverse, comprising a wide range of species that have evolved to thrive in various environments. One of the fundamental aspects that distinguish these species is their mode of existence, which can be broadly categorized into two types: motile and sessile life forms. Motile life forms are those that are capable of moving from one place to another, while sessile life forms are anchored to a fixed location and are unable to move. In this article, we will delve into the world of Animalia and explore the differences between motile and sessile life forms, highlighting their characteristics, advantages, and disadvantages.

The distinction between motile and sessile life forms is not unique to Animalia, as it can be observed in other kingdoms of life, such as Plantae and Fungi. However, the diversity of motile and sessile life forms is particularly pronounced in the animal kingdom, where species have evolved to occupy a wide range of ecological niches. From the majestic blue whale to the humble sea sponge, animals have developed unique strategies to survive and thrive in their environments, and their mode of existence plays a crucial role in determining their ecological success.

Motile Life Forms: Characteristics and Advantages

Motile life forms are characterized by their ability to move from one place to another, which allows them to explore their environment, search for food, and escape from predators. This mode of existence has several advantages, including the ability to colonize new habitats, exploit new resources, and adapt to changing environmental conditions. Motile life forms can be further divided into two subcategories: swimming and walking/crawling species. Swimming species, such as fish and dolphins, have evolved to thrive in aquatic environments, while walking/crawling species, such as insects and mammals, have adapted to life on land.

One of the key advantages of motile life forms is their ability to respond to environmental cues, such as the presence of food or predators. For example, many species of fish have evolved to migrate between different habitats in response to changes in water temperature or the availability of food. Similarly, many species of mammals have developed complex migration patterns in response to changes in food availability or weather patterns. This ability to respond to environmental cues allows motile life forms to adapt to changing conditions and exploit new resources, which is essential for their survival and success.
